Share Your Love of the English Language around the World with Our Online Bachelor’s Degree in Teaching English as a Second Language

If you travel abroad for business or pleasure, you will find that English is the dominant language used for communicating. Not only do people from two different cultures use English for communication but you will also find it in computer programming and many different fields. Often students abroad who study psychology will study English to better understand their textbooks. The best computer programmers in other countries also need English to keep up with the latest changes in technology. A career as an ESL teacher is an exciting and stimulating experience. Travel abroad and learn about new cultures while you share and educate other nations about your culture.

Liberty University’s online bachelor’s degree in teaching English as a second language provides the credentials you need to be more competitive when competing for jobs both here and abroad as an English language instructor. In South America, Asia, the Middle East, and Europe, you will find many students yearning to study English as a second language. Throughout this degree, you will learn not only the linguistic skills you need but also how to overcome cultural barriers and reach students struggling to cope with the complexity of the English language.

What Will You Learn in our Bachelor’s Degree in Teaching English as a Second Language?

  • Learn to prepare a curriculum with your student’s language in mind.
  • Understand how students acquire language.
  • Gain comprehensive knowledge in applied grammar, linguistics, and second language acquisition.

Throughout this degree, you will learn the intricacies of the English language and how to best utilize the resources available to you to meet the needs of your students. You will also learn about the various activities and class exercises that will help not only make you a better instructor but also enable students to have fun while you are teaching them. Our internship program can give you the skills, knowledge, and wisdom to be successful and confident in the classroom in your future career.

Potential Careers

  • ESL teacher
  • Academic coordinator
  • Curriculum planner
